Honey and Milk Sunburn Relief

Sunburn can be a serious dilemma in our skincare. Two natural ingredients to ease sunburn
are milk and honey. As milk contains lactic acid, it serves as a gentle exfoliant in removing
dead skin. Meanwhile, the honey contributes to the soothing part of not leaving the skin too
dry after exfoliating.
Here is a simple procedure making honey and milk easy homemade skincare for sunburn
relief:
Grind the 1/2 cup of oats
Add the powder to 1/4 cup of milk and few tablespoons of honey
Mix both thoroughly
Apply to your skin for 20 minutes

Homemade Lip Sugar Scrub

When exposed to different climates, there is a skin cell build-up on the lips that caused it to be
flaky at times. As a homemade skincare solution, sugar and honey are the best solutions.
Here is the easy procedure:
Mix one teaspoon of honey with two teaspoons of sugar
Massage the mixture into your lips and leave for 10 minutes or so
Remove with the help of wet face washer
Moisturizing Aloe Face Mask

The secret is already out about the power of the aloe vera plant in terms of skincare. It has a
variety of skin health benefits such as moisturizer and acne treatment. It also has this pumping
and glowing boosting effect for any type of skin. Isn’t it amazing?
How to make an aloe face mask at home?
Mix 1/2 tablespoon of almond milk with a tablespoon of brown sugar until it dissolves.
Add four tablespoons of aloe vera juice or gel.
Apply the mixture onto the face and stay for 15-20 minutes
Remove with warm water and use a soft & clean towel to dry face
